Лабораторная работа 7. Создание отчетов

Цели работы:

  • научиться создавать отчеты;

Задание 1. Откройте свою учебную базу данных «Компьютерная школа».

Задание 2. Создайте автоотчет в столбец на основании запроса Адрес.

· Откройте закладку Отчеты, если находитесь в другом окне.

· Щелкните по кнопке Создать.

· В появившемся диалоговом окне Новый отчет выберите Автоотчет: в столбец и в качестве источника данных запрос Адрес.

· Щелкните по кнопке ОК. Появится страница просмотра отчета.

· Сохраните отчет с именем Адрес. Закройте отчет.

Замечание. Этот отчет составлен на основании запроса. При изменении запроса Адрес изменится и отчет. Это дает возможность, например, распечатать адрес только одного ученика.

· Откройте закладку Запросы и выделите запрос Адрес.

· Откройте запрос в режиме Конструктор: щелкните по кнопке Конструктор.

· Введите условие отбора фамилии: Баранова.

· Выполните запрос, щелкнув по кнопке Лабораторная работа 7. Создание отчетов - student2.ru . Сохраните его и закройте.

· Перейдите на закладку Отчеты. Откройте отчет Адрес. В списке вывода будут находиться данные только одного человека – Барановой.

Задание 3. Создайте ленточный автоотчетна основании запроса Номера телефонов.

· Откройте закладку Отчеты, если находитесь в другом окне.

· Щелкните по кнопке Создать.

· В появившемся диалоговом окне Новый отчет выберите Автоотчет: ленточный и в качестве источника данных запрос Номера телефонов.

· Щелкните по кнопке ОК. Появится страница просмотра отчета. Закройте страницу просмотра.

· Сохраните отчет с именем Номера телефонов. Закройте отчет.

Пояснение: Для подобных отчетов удобно использовать Запрос с параметром. Создадим запрос с параметром для запроса Номера телефонов.

Лабораторная работа 7. Создание отчетов - student2.ru

· Откройте закладку Запросы и выделите запрос Номера телефонов.

· Откройте запрос в режиме Конструктор.

· Напечатайте в качестве условия отбора в квадратных скобках фразу: [Введите фамилию] (рис.1.) Эти слова будут появляться каждый раз при выполнении запроса.

· Выполните запрос, щелкнув по кнопке Лабораторная работа 7. Создание отчетов - student2.ru . Появится диалоговое окно Введите значение параметра с просьбой ввести фамилию человека, для которого вы хотите получить информацию.

· Введите фамилию Корнилова и щелкните по кнопке ОК.

· Сохраните запрос и закройте его.

· Перейдите на закладку Отчеты

· Откройте отчет Номера телефонов. Появится точно такой же вопрос о фамилии. Введите любую фамилию, например Корнилова. В списке вывода будут данные только одного человека.

Задание 4. Внесите изменения в готовые отчеты.

· Если вы закрыли отчет Номера телефонов, то откройте его заново.

· Щелкните по кнопке Лабораторная работа 7. Создание отчетов - student2.ru - Вид для перехода в режим Конструктор. Все изменения в отчет можно вводить только в этом режиме.

Справочная информация: В окне Конструктор отчетов находятся пять областей:

Заголовок отчета – все, что находится в этой области, выводится только один раз в начале отчета;

Верхний колонтитул - все, что находится в этой области, выводится в верхней части каждой страницы;

Область данных – содержит собственно записи;

Нижний колонтитул - все, что находится в этой области, выводится в нижней части каждой страницы;

Примечание отчета – все, что находится в этой области, выводится только один раз в конце отчета.

В окне Конструкторотчетов, представленном на рис. 2, в заголовке отчета находится надпись Номера телефонов, в верхнем колонтитуле – заголовки столбцов вывода, в области данных – записи, в нижнем колонтитуле – дата текущего дня.

Лабораторная работа 7. Создание отчетов - student2.ru

· Исправьте заголовок отчета на Номер телефона учащегося. Смените цвет букв, их размер и шрифт.

· Перейдите в режим предварительного просмотра, щелкнув по кнопке Лабораторная работа 7. Создание отчетов - student2.ru . Введите фамилию из списка учащихся и посмотрите что получилось.

· Закройте отчет предварительно сохранив его.

Задание 5. Создайте отчет Справка с помощью Конструктора.

Лабораторная работа 7. Создание отчетов - student2.ru Рассмотрим ситуацию, когда стандартный отчет нас не устраивает. Например, вы хотите сконструировать стандартную справку об обучении и выдавать ее по запросу. Сначала следует создать запрос с параметром Справка (рис.3.), в котором будут только интересующие вас записи, затем следует приступить к созданию отчета.

· Откройте закладку Отчеты, если находитесь в другом окне.

· Щелкните по кнопке Создать.

· В появившемся диалоговом окне Новый отчет выберите режим Конструктори в качестве источника данных запрос Справка.

· Щелкните по кнопке ОК. Появится Конструктор для создания отчетов и панель с вспомогательными кнопками.

Предъявите преподавателю: запросы Лицей, Гимназия, Добавление, 10_класс, 9_класс, Удаление, Новая_таблица и Word.

MICROSOFT POWERPOINT

Наши рекомендации